How to Identify a High-Quality Cardboard Hanger (and Avoid Cheap Alternatives)

2026-08-18 17:00:15

Most cardboard hangers look similar in a product photo, but the difference between one that holds a garment properly for years and one that sags within weeks comes down to six things: material, thickness, density, load capacity, structural design, and quality testing. Cheap alternatives cut corners on all six at once, which is why they're lighter, cheaper, and fail faster. This guide breaks down exactly what to check before ordering, so you're evaluating a supplier on real specs instead of a photo.

High-Quality vs. Low-Grade Cardboard Hangers: Key Differences

FactorHigh-Quality HangerLow-Grade Alternative
MaterialRecycled cardboard, biodegradable, FSC-certifiedLow-grade paper or thin cardboard, often non-recycled
Thickness2.5–3mm standard; 3.5–4mm reinforced for coats1–1.5mm, prone to bending
Density650–750 g/m² cardboard300–400 g/m²
Load-Bearing Capacity5–7kg for a single hanger1–2kg before deformation
Structural DesignReinforced hook & crossbar, double-layer supportFlat, single-layer design
Manufacturing ProcessDie-cutting, embossing, lamination, precision gluingSimple cutting, minimal finishing
Quality TestingISO 9001-certified, stress & load tests, batch inspectionRarely tested, no standardized procedure
Eco ComplianceBiodegradable, recyclable, sustainableUsually non-recyclable, limited eco-certification

What to Check Before You Order

1. Material and Certification

Ask specifically whether the material is FSC-certified recycled cardboard, not just "eco-friendly" as a marketing claim. Low-grade paper or thin, non-recycled cardboard can still be marketed as sustainable without meeting any actual certification standard — the certification itself is what you should ask to see.

2. Thickness and Density

Thickness and density work together to determine rigidity. A hanger at 1–1.5mm thickness and 300–400 g/m² density will bend under a heavier garment, while 2.5–3mm at 650–750 g/m² holds its shape. For coats and heavier outerwear, look for a reinforced version in the 3.5–4mm range rather than assuming a standard hanger will hold up.

3. Load-Bearing Capacity

Ask for the tested load capacity in kilograms, not a vague durability claim. A well-built hanger holds 5–7kg without deforming; a low-grade one can start bending under 1–2kg — the difference between a hanger that lasts through repeated retail handling and one that fails on the rack.

4. Structural Design

Look closely at the hook and crossbar — these are the points that fail first under load. A reinforced hook with double-layer support at the crossbar distributes weight far better than a flat, single-layer cutout, which is the most common shortcut in cheaper hangers.

5. Manufacturing Process

Die-cutting, embossing, lamination, and precision gluing all add cost but also add strength and finish quality. Simple cutting with minimal finishing is faster and cheaper to produce, but it shows up as rough edges, weaker joints, and less structural integrity in the finished hanger.

6. Quality Testing

Ask whether the supplier performs stress and load testing with batch inspection, or whether testing is informal and inconsistent. ISO 9001 certification is worth confirming directly — it indicates a documented, repeatable quality process rather than testing done on an ad hoc basis.

Matching the Hanger to the Garment

  • Standard clothing (shirts, dresses, light jackets): 2.5–3mm cardboard with standard hook and crossbar reinforcement

  • Coats and heavier outerwear: 3.5–4mm reinforced construction with double-layer crossbar support

  • Custom branding needs: full color printing, logo embossing, and die-cut hook styles for retail presentation

Frequently Asked Questions

1. What is a Paper Hanger?

A paper hanger is a hanger made from cardboard, recycled paper, or other eco-friendly materials, designed to support garments while minimizing environmental impact.

2. How can I tell if a cardboard hanger is actually high-quality?

Check the material certification (FSC-certified recycled cardboard), thickness (2.5mm or more for standard use), density (650+ g/m²), and whether the supplier can provide tested load capacity and quality inspection documentation rather than general durability claims.

3. Are Paper Hangers strong enough for coats and jackets?

Yes, provided they're built for it — reinforced hangers at 3.5–4mm thickness with double-layer crossbar support are designed specifically for heavier garments like coats and jackets, unlike standard-weight hangers meant for lighter clothing.

4. Can cardboard hangers be customized?

Yes. Full color printing, logo embossing, die-cut shapes, and different hook styles are common customization options for brands looking to align hangers with their retail presentation.
